The US dollar in 2025: A year of change and what lies ahead
The greenback has had a rough ride in 2025, down roughly 9% so far this year.
Yet this weakness has not played out evenly across global currencies. The Swiss franc, the euro and the Norwegian and Swedish krona have rallied strongly, while others, such as the Japanese yen and Canadian dollar, have been broadly flat.
